#8fcc93 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8fcc93 is composed of 56.1% red, 80%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.9%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 123.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.4% and a lightness of 68%. #8fcc93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1f9927.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#8fcc93

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040905 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8fcc93

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8b3a9 is the less saturated color, while #5dfe67 is the most saturated one.
